。
翻转效果是一种常见的前端开发技术,可以通过改变图片的方向或者镜像来实现。在实现翻转效果时,可以使用图片源srcset属性与下一代图像格式.webp相结合,以提高网页加载速度和用户体验。
图片源srcset是HTML5中的一个属性,用于指定一组备选图片源,浏览器会根据设备的屏幕分辨率和网络状况选择合适的图片进行加载。通过在srcset属性中指定不同分辨率的图片,可以在不同设备上展示不同大小的图片,从而提高网页加载速度。
下一代图像格式.webp是一种由Google开发的图像格式,具有更高的压缩率和更好的图像质量。相比于传统的JPEG和PNG格式,.webp格式可以减小图片文件的大小,从而减少网页加载时间。同时,.webp格式还支持透明度和动画,可以满足更多的设计需求。
简单的翻转效果可以通过CSS的transform属性来实现,例如使用scaleX(-1)来实现水平翻转效果,使用scaleY(-1)来实现垂直翻转效果。在HTML中,可以使用img标签来插入图片,并在srcset属性中指定不同分辨率的图片源,同时指定图片格式为.webp。
以下是一个示例代码:
<img src="image.jpg" srcset="image@2x.jpg 2x, image@3x.jpg 3x" alt="翻转图片" style="transform: scaleX(-1);">
在上述代码中,image.jpg是默认的图片源,image@2x.jpg和image@3x.jpg分别是2倍和3倍屏幕分辨率下的备选图片源。style属性中的transform: scaleX(-1)表示对图片进行水平翻转。
推荐的腾讯云相关产品是腾讯云图片处理(Image Processing),该产品提供了丰富的图片处理能力,包括图片格式转换、图片裁剪、图片缩放等功能。您可以通过腾讯云图片处理API来实现图片的翻转效果。具体产品介绍和API文档,请参考腾讯云官方网站:腾讯云图片处理。
领取专属 10元无门槛券
手把手带您无忧上云